Woman brutally murdered after being taken to hotel, accused sentenced to death

Sudeshna Mandal, Kakdwip: The judge of the Kakdwip Sub-Divisional Court sentenced the accused to death for the brutal murder of the woman. On Wednesday, the police of Fraserganj Coastal Police Station presented the accused in the South 24 Parganas Kakdwip Sub-Divisional Court on the charge of brutal murder of the woman (murder in the hotel room). Justice Tapan Mandal sentenced the accused Samar Patra to death on the basis of all the evidence.

Significantly, on April 12, 2018, the accused Samar Patra had taken a woman named Durga to a hotel from Dariknagar area of ​​Fraserganj Coastal Police Station area. There is an allegation of brutally murdering a woman in that hotel (Murder in a Hotel Room). After the murder, he escaped by breaking the window of the hotel. As soon as this incident came to the fore, there was a sensation in the whole area. After the recovery of the dead body, the police of Fraserganj Coastal Police Station have started the investigation of the incident along with the postmortem. A month and a half after the investigation began, the accused was arrested by the police of Fraserganj Coastal Police Station. Police has registered a case against the accused person under several non-bailable sections including murder. Investigating Officer Arpan Naik along with forensic experts visited the spot several times and also recorded statements of several witnesses. After a long legal process, the accused Samar Patra was finally sentenced to death by the Kakdwip Sub-Divisional Court.
